Utoljára aktív 1752819455

gnome-extensions.sh Eredeti
1sudo apt install gnome-shell-extension
2sudo apt install pipx
3sudo apt install gnome-tweaks
4sudo apt install gnome-extensions-app
5sudo apt pipx install gnome-extensions-cli --system-site-packages
6
7# Turn off default Ubuntu extensions
8gnome-extensions disable tiling-assistant@ubuntu.com
9gnome-extensions disable ubuntu-appindicators@ubuntu.com
10gnome-extensions disable ubuntu-dock@ubuntu.com
11gnome-extensions disable ding@rastersoft.com
12
13# Pause to assure user is ready to accept confirmations
14gum confirm "To install Gnome extensions, you need to accept some confirmations. Ready?"
15
16# Install new extensions
17gext install tactile@lundal.io
18gext install just-perfection-desktop@just-perfection
19gext install blur-my-shell@aunetx
20gext install space-bar@luchrioh
21gext install undecorate@sun.wxg@gmail.com
22gext install AlphabeticalAppGrid@stuarthayhurst
23
24# Compile gsettings schemas in order to be able to set them
25sudo cp ~/.local/share/gnome-shell/extensions/tactile@lundal.io/schemas/org.gnome.shell.extensions.tactile.gschema.xml /usr/share/glib-2.0/schemas/
26sudo cp ~/.local/share/gnome-shell/extensions/just-perfection-desktop\@just-perfection/schemas/org.gnome.shell.extensions.just-perfection.gschema.xml /usr/share/glib-2.0/schemas/
27sudo cp ~/.local/share/gnome-shell/extensions/blur-my-shell\@aunetx/schemas/org.gnome.shell.extensions.blur-my-shell.gschema.xml /usr/share/glib-2.0/schemas/
28sudo cp ~/.local/share/gnome-shell/extensions/space-bar\@luchrioh/schemas/org.gnome.shell.extensions.space-bar.gschema.xml /usr/share/glib-2.0/schemas/
29sudo cp ~/.local/share/gnome-shell/extensions/AlphabeticalAppGrid\@stuarthayhurst/schemas/org.gnome.shell.extensions.AlphabeticalAppGrid.gschema.xml /usr/share/glib-2.0/schemas/
30sudo glib-compile-schemas /usr/share/glib-2.0/schemas/
31
32# Configure Tactile
33gsettings set org.gnome.shell.extensions.tactile col-0 1
34gsettings set org.gnome.shell.extensions.tactile col-1 2
35gsettings set org.gnome.shell.extensions.tactile col-2 1
36gsettings set org.gnome.shell.extensions.tactile col-3 0
37gsettings set org.gnome.shell.extensions.tactile row-0 1
38gsettings set org.gnome.shell.extensions.tactile row-1 1
39gsettings set org.gnome.shell.extensions.tactile gap-size 32
40
41# Configure Just Perfection
42gsettings set org.gnome.shell.extensions.just-perfection animation 4
43gsettings set org.gnome.shell.extensions.just-perfection dash-app-running true
44gsettings set org.gnome.shell.extensions.just-perfection workspace true
45gsettings set org.gnome.shell.extensions.just-perfection workspace-popup false
46
47# Configure Blur My Shell
48gsettings set org.gnome.shell.extensions.blur-my-shell.appfolder blur false
49gsettings set org.gnome.shell.extensions.blur-my-shell.lockscreen blur false
50gsettings set org.gnome.shell.extensions.blur-my-shell.screenshot blur false
51gsettings set org.gnome.shell.extensions.blur-my-shell.window-list blur false
52gsettings set org.gnome.shell.extensions.blur-my-shell.panel blur false
53gsettings set org.gnome.shell.extensions.blur-my-shell.overview blur true
54gsettings set org.gnome.shell.extensions.blur-my-shell.overview pipeline 'pipeline_default'
55gsettings set org.gnome.shell.extensions.blur-my-shell.dash-to-dock blur true
56gsettings set org.gnome.shell.extensions.blur-my-shell.dash-to-dock brightness 0.6
57gsettings set org.gnome.shell.extensions.blur-my-shell.dash-to-dock sigma 30
58gsettings set org.gnome.shell.extensions.blur-my-shell.dash-to-dock static-blur true
59gsettings set org.gnome.shell.extensions.blur-my-shell.dash-to-dock style-dash-to-dock 0
60
61# Configure Space Bar
62gsettings set org.gnome.shell.extensions.space-bar.behavior smart-workspace-names false
63gsettings set org.gnome.shell.extensions.space-bar.shortcuts enable-activate-workspace-shortcuts false
64gsettings set org.gnome.shell.extensions.space-bar.shortcuts enable-move-to-workspace-shortcuts true
65gsettings set org.gnome.shell.extensions.space-bar.shortcuts open-menu "@as []"
66
67# Configure AlphabeticalAppGrid
68gsettings set org.gnome.shell.extensions.alphabetical-app-grid folder-order-position 'end'